The fight originally scheduled for the end of 2010, but the Algerian authorities stepped in and announced the fight could not take place and it was re-scheduled for last Friday. It has now been called off again for seemingly the same reason and has been given an initial date on July 5th for the bout to be completed.
It is a farce.
